D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Governance Framework Development
  • Develop and maintain governance frameworks, policies, and procedures for IAM aligned with industry standards and organizational requirements


  • Policy Enforcement

  • Implement and enforce IAM policies and procedures to maintain consistency and compliance throughout the organization
  • Risk Assessment and Mitigation
  • Conduct risk assessments of IAM processes and recommend controls to minimize security risks


  • Access Certifications

  • Manage access certifications in SailPoint Identity IQ, including scheduling, conducting access reviews, and ensuring timely completion of certifications


  • Compliance Reporting

  • Generate reports and metrics on IAM governance activities, compliance status, access certifications, and audit findings
  • Vendor and Technology Evaluation
  • Evaluate IAM solutions and technologies to support governance objectives


  • Training and Awareness

  • Develop and deliver training programs to educate employees on IAM governance principles and best practices
